Documentation: routes / errorPage

Purpose: Generates error page views for HTTP status codes.
Lifecycle Role: Error handler middleware or route.
Dependencies:
Upstream:
  • getErrorContext
Downstream:
  • index
Data Flow:
Inputs: HTTP error code param.
Outputs: Rendered error page HTML.
Side Effects: None.
Performance and Scalability:
Bottlenecks: None.
Concurrency: None.
Security and Stability:
Validation: Error code validated; fallback to 500 on invalid.
Vulnerabilities: None.
Architecture Assessment:
Coupling: Low; depends on error context util.
Abstraction: Simple rendering module.
Recommendations:
  • Add localization support.
  • Support custom error pages per route.
  • Ensure robust fallback for missing context.